Transaction 85c0858d6718e59808f13c24ccf79b1d3b3f77359ffaa0effe7a55510a1bf723
1 Input
2 Outputs
- 85c0858d6718e59808f13c24ccf79b1d3b3f77359ffaa0effe7a55510a1bf723:0
- 85c0858d6718e59808f13c24ccf79b1d3b3f77359ffaa0effe7a55510a1bf723:1
value 1000000
address 19uvUH15fyXCzFkU16WRCizhRzv3F6SmhW
value 1076992
address 3GEaT8ZRXELcjMSFvGro6eZcC5S1LSLZuN